What an invoice html template bootstrap 5 for higher education is

An invoice html template built with Bootstrap 5 for higher education is a responsive, accessible HTML invoice scaffold tailored to campus billing workflows, student accounts, grants, and departmental invoicing. It includes semantic markup, Bootstrap utility classes, and placeholders for institutional branding, student identifiers, billing line items, tax and scholarship adjustments, and payment links. Designed for integration with document management and eSignature platforms, the template supports embedding signature fields, PDF generation, and server-side data injection from student information systems or CRMs while preserving a consistent layout across devices.

Common invoicing challenges in higher education

  • Inconsistent formats across departments cause reconciliation delays and student confusion when billing details vary.
  • Handling scholarships, grants, and adjustments increases invoice complexity and the risk of calculation errors.
  • Maintaining FERPA-compliant student data on invoices requires strict access controls and auditability.
  • Mobile and print views can break layout without responsive, table-aware design tailored for invoices.

Core template features to include

Design your invoice template with these four capabilities to meet higher education invoicing needs and ensure smooth operations across departments.

Responsive Layout

A Bootstrap 5 structure ensures invoices display correctly on phones, tablets, and desktops while preserving printable formatting for offline records and compliance copies.

Field Placeholders

Use consistent placeholders for student ID, chartstring, grant numbers, and line items to simplify automated population from SIS or finance systems without manual edits.

Accessible Markup

Include semantic HTML and ARIA attributes so invoices meet accessibility standards and remain usable by assistive technologies for students and staff.

eSignature Hooks

Embed identifiable signature anchor points and metadata so eSignature tools can place, track, and record signatures within rendered PDFs consistently.

Best practices when using the invoice template

Adopt these practices to improve accuracy, security, and the student or payer experience when issuing academic invoices.

Standardize field names and formats
Maintain a consistent field naming convention across templates and integrations so scripted data population is reliable and fewer manual edits are required during invoice generation.
Minimize sensitive data exposure
Avoid including unnecessary identifiers on invoices; use masked or truncated IDs and ensure delivery channels are secure to reduce FERPA and privacy risk.
Validate calculations programmatically
Implement server-side validation for totals, taxes, and scholarship adjustments before rendering PDFs to prevent billing errors and reduce dispute rates.
Keep template versions controlled
Use version control and a changelog for templates so financial teams can audit changes, roll back to prior versions, and maintain consistent historical records.
